Drama Unfolds as Vusi Nova Chases TK Nciza and Nhlanhla Mafu Out of Zahara’s House

Vusi Nova Takes Charge: Expels TK Nciza and Nhlanhla Mafu from Zahara’s Residence Amid Funeral Arrangement Tensions

In a dramatic and tense turn of events, renowned South African musician Vusi Nova reportedly took matters into his own hands, forcibly removing ANC Provincial Secretary Thembinkosi “TK” Nciza and his ex-wife Nhlanhla Mafu from Zahara’s Roodepoort residence.

The ANC Secretary and his ex-wife allegedly visited Zahara’s home to pay their last respects to the late musician’s family. However, their presence sparked controversy as they were notably absent during Zahara’s hospitalization.

Absent Support Sparks Outrage
Sources reveal that TK Nciza and Nhlanhla Mafu, who were not present during Zahara’s time of need, arrived at the house and extended their condolences to Zahara’s mother. In an unexpected move, TK Nciza suggested that the ANC should take charge of the funeral arrangements and relocate Zahara’s body from the current mortuary. This proposal did not sit well with Zahara’s inner circle.

“They were not present during her time of need. The family reached out to them for assistance, but no one was there for her, except for her fiancé Mpho,” a source disclosed.

Outrage and Intervention
The offer from TK Nciza, especially given Zahara’s past accusations of exploitation against him and Dj Sbu during their time under the TS Records label, triggered outrage among those present. Vusi Nova, a close friend of Zahara, expressed his discontent upon learning of TK Nciza’s proposal.

“He told them sh*$t and chased them out of the house. Where were they the entire time?,” a source revealed about Vusi Nova’s reaction.

Controversy and Family’s Focus
As the controversy unfolds, Zahara’s family remains focused on honoring her memory and ensuring a dignified farewell. Despite the tensions surrounding funeral arrangements, Vusi Nova’s decisive actions underscore the emotions and complexities surrounding the final farewell to the late South African songstress.

IN OTHER NEWS: Green Energy Revolution Sweeps Across Africa: A Beacon of Hope for Sustainable Future

In recent years, the African continent has emerged as a powerhouse in the global transition towards sustainable and green energy solutions. From solar farms stretching across the Sahara to innovative wind energy projects along the coasts, Africa is leading the way in harnessing the power of nature to meet its growing energy needs.

Solar Sahara: Illuminating the Continent with Clean Energy

One of the most remarkable developments is the proliferation of solar energy projects across the vast expanse of the Sahara Desert. Stretching from Morocco to Sudan, solar farms are transforming arid landscapes into powerhouses of clean, renewable energy.

These projects not only generate electricity for local communities but also have the potential to export excess energy to neighboring regions, fostering regional cooperation and economic development.

Wind of Change: Harnessing Coastal Breezes for Sustainable Power

The coastal regions of Africa are not left behind in the race towards green energy. Wind farms are sprouting along the shores, capturing the steady breezes that sweep across the Atlantic and Indian Oceans. Countries like Kenya and South Africa are investing in cutting-edge wind turbine technology to generate electricity efficiently, reducing dependence on fossil fuels and curbing greenhouse gas emissions.

Empowering Rural Communities: Microgrid Solutions Take Center Stage

In many remote areas where traditional power infrastructure is impractical, microgrid solutions are stepping in to fill the gap. These small-scale, decentralized energy systems are powered by a combination of solar, wind, and sometimes biomass sources.

They are providing electricity to off-grid villages, empowering communities and improving living standards. The success of these microgrid initiatives demonstrates that sustainable energy is not just an urban luxury but a necessity for equitable development.

Investment Boom: Global Players Bet on Africa’s Green Future

International investors are increasingly recognizing the potential of Africa’s green energy sector. Major corporations and foreign governments are pouring billions into large-scale projects, fostering technological advancements and creating job opportunities. The investment boom is not only helping Africa meet its energy demands sustainably but is also positioning the continent as a key player in the global green energy market.

Challenges and Opportunities: Navigating the Path to a Greener Tomorrow

Despite the remarkable progress, challenges persist. Issues such as financing, infrastructure development, and policy frameworks require careful consideration. However, these challenges are seen as opportunities for innovation and collaboration. African nations are working together to overcome hurdles and create a sustainable energy landscape that benefits both current and future generations.

As the rest of the world watches, Africa is proving that the future of energy lies in harnessing the power of nature responsibly. The green energy revolution on the continent not only addresses the pressing issue of climate change but also provides a blueprint for a brighter and more sustainable future for us all.
